For what it's worth, the backgammon engine in Debian now (GNU Backgammon, which I package as gnubg) uses a trained neural network that was constructed in much the way that you describe (training the network by playing it against itself for substantial amounts of time). It's been in Debian for many years, long before I packaged it. I think it's the preferred form of modification in this case because upstream does not have, so far as I know, any special data set or additional information or resources beyond what's included in the source package. They would make any changes exactly the same way any user of the package would: instantiating the net and further training it, or starting over and training a new network.
